Health and wellness experts now emphasize that incorporating small, calming rituals into your nightly routine can support better sleep quality. These simple practices are supported by recent studies and are increasingly recommended by sleep specialists as part of good sleep hygiene.
Multiple wellness sources suggest that establishing a consistent pre-sleep routine can help signal the body that it is time to rest, thereby improving sleep onset and duration. Common rituals include activities like reading a book, gentle stretching, meditation, or listening to calming music. Experts say these routines can help reduce stress and mental clutter, making it easier to fall asleep.
While there is no single ritual proven to work for everyone, the emphasis is on consistency and creating a relaxing environment. Sleep specialists note that these small habits are supportive, not curative, and should complement other sleep hygiene practices such as maintaining a regular sleep schedule and limiting screen time before bed. The advice is based on a growing body of wellness guidance rather than a specific new scientific breakthrough.

Key Questions
Can small rituals really improve my sleep?
Yes, many experts agree that consistent, calming routines before bed can help signal your body to prepare for sleep, potentially leading to better sleep quality.
What are some recommended rituals to try?
Common suggestions include reading a book, gentle stretching, listening to calming music, or practicing mindfulness meditation. Choose activities that relax you personally and can be done regularly.
How long should I perform my bedtime ritual?
Most routines last between 10 to 30 minutes, depending on personal preference. The key is consistency and creating a relaxing environment.
Are these rituals effective for everyone?
Effectiveness varies among individuals. While many find these routines helpful, some may need to experiment to discover what best supports their sleep.
Should I avoid screens before doing my ritual?
Yes, limiting screen time before bed is generally recommended, as blue light can interfere with melatonin production and sleep onset.
